Analysis
Yemen recorded 48 for percentage of live births who received bacille calmette-guerin in 2025.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 4.0% on the previous year and up 14.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, percentage of live births who received bacille calmette-guerin in Yemen peaked at 95 in 1990 and was at its lowest, 9, in 1980.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 46 years of available data.
Percentage of live births who received bacille Calmette-Guerin in Yemen,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1980 | 9 | — |
| 1981 | 12 | +33.3% |
| 1982 | 13 | +8.3% |
| 1983 | 15 | +15.4% |
| 1984 | 16 | +6.7% |
| 1985 | 20 | +25.0% |
| 1986 | 23 | +15.0% |
| 1987 | 30 | +30.4% |
| 1988 | 52 | +73.3% |
| 1989 | 75 | +44.2% |
| 1990 | 95 | +26.7% |
| 1991 | 63 | -33.7% |
| 1992 | 54 | -14.3% |
| 1993 | 57 | +5.6% |
| 1994 | 41 | -28.1% |
| 1995 | 60 | +46.3% |
| 1996 | 58 | -3.3% |
| 1997 | 54 | -6.9% |
| 1998 | 66 | +22.2% |
| 1999 | 79 | +19.7% |
| 2000 | 82 | +3.8% |
| 2001 | 78 | -4.9% |
| 2002 | 73 | -6.4% |
| 2003 | 66 | -9.6% |
| 2004 | 64 | -3.0% |
| 2005 | 66 | +3.1% |
| 2006 | 67 | +1.5% |
| 2007 | 64 | -4.5% |
| 2008 | 60 | -6.2% |
| 2009 | 58 | -3.3% |
| 2010 | 65 | +12.1% |
| 2011 | 59 | -9.2% |
| 2012 | 64 | +8.5% |
| 2013 | 67 | +4.7% |
| 2014 | 70 | +4.5% |
| 2015 | 42 | -40.0% |
| 2016 | 67 | +59.5% |
| 2017 | 59 | -11.9% |
| 2018 | 55 | -6.8% |
| 2019 | 59 | +7.3% |
| 2020 | 59 | +0.0% |
| 2021 | 60 | +1.7% |
| 2022 | 63 | +5.0% |
| 2023 | 54 | -14.3% |
| 2024 | 50 | -7.4% |
| 2025 | 48 | -4.0% |

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 26.5 | 9 | 75 | 10 |
| 1990s | 62.7 | 41 | 95 | 10 |
| 2000s | 67.8 | 58 | 82 | 10 |
| 2010s | 60.7 | 42 | 70 | 10 |
| 2020s | 55.67 | 48 | 63 | 6 |
